Node.js中如何加载ECMAScript模块中的JSON文件?

2026-03-31 14:390阅读0评论SEO基础
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1110个文字,预计阅读时间需要5分钟。

Node.js中如何加载ECMAScript模块中的JSON文件?

在ECMAScript模块中,使用Node.js加载JSON文件的方法如下:

以下是一个简单的示例,展示如何在Node.js中加载并解析JSON文件:

javascript// 引入内置的fs模块const fs=require('fs');

// 定义JSON文件的路径const filePath='./data.json';

// 使用fs.readFile读取文件fs.readFile(filePath, 'utf8', (err, data)=> { if (err) { console.error('读取文件失败:', err); return; }

// 解析JSON字符串 try { const jsonData=JSON.parse(data); console.log(jsonData); } catch (parseErr) { console.error('解析JSON失败:', parseErr); }});

看完这篇文档,您将学到:

1.如何使用Node.js读取文件系统中的JSON文件。

2.如何使用`fs.readFile`方法异步读取文件内容。

3.如何使用`JSON.parse`方法将读取到的JSON字符串转换为JavaScript对象。

阅读全文

本文共计1110个文字,预计阅读时间需要5分钟。

Node.js中如何加载ECMAScript模块中的JSON文件?

在ECMAScript模块中,使用Node.js加载JSON文件的方法如下:

以下是一个简单的示例,展示如何在Node.js中加载并解析JSON文件:

javascript// 引入内置的fs模块const fs=require('fs');

// 定义JSON文件的路径const filePath='./data.json';

// 使用fs.readFile读取文件fs.readFile(filePath, 'utf8', (err, data)=> { if (err) { console.error('读取文件失败:', err); return; }

// 解析JSON字符串 try { const jsonData=JSON.parse(data); console.log(jsonData); } catch (parseErr) { console.error('解析JSON失败:', parseErr); }});

看完这篇文档,您将学到:

1.如何使用Node.js读取文件系统中的JSON文件。

2.如何使用`fs.readFile`方法异步读取文件内容。

3.如何使用`JSON.parse`方法将读取到的JSON字符串转换为JavaScript对象。

阅读全文